Hotel Gerard & Francine is surrounded by an extraordinary garden on the beautiful beach of Ambatoloaka and its lagoon in Nosy Be.

Gerard and Francine strive to implement sustainable, eco-friendly tourism with a sensitive ecological approach to the local, Nosy Be culture in diversity, abundance, and natural beauty.

The guest rooms of the hotel offer a stunning sea view, around the lovely veranda of the Great House and the magnificent tropical garden in front of the Bungalow. The decor uses typical Malagasy architecture, traditional construction with wood floors and creole ceilings. It is a wide mix of exotic woodworking with endemic, replanted, materials. The cloth-work and other pure textile products are made by local, Malagasy artisans of Nosy Be. The furniture is entirely constructed at the hotel. All the rooms are equipped with fans, mosquito nets, individual safes, minibar, solar-heated water, shower sink, and toilet. There are seven rooms in the Bungalow and the Great House with verandas.
There is one room in the Great House with private shower and communal toilet and one air-conditioned room in the Great House without a view of the ocean.

Frequently Asked Questions: Nosy Be & Ambatoloaka

Is the beach at Gérard et Francine good for swimming? Absolutely. The hotel sits on a beautiful stretch of Ambatoloaka beach where the water is calm and clear. It’s perfect for a morning swim or a leisurely walk along the shore. At sunset, the beach transforms into a stunning vantage point for one of the best views on the island.

What excursions can I do from the hotel? Gérard et Francine is a perfect hub for exploring. We can arrange day trips to the Lokobe Primary Forest to see lemurs and chameleons, or boat excursions to the smaller islands like Nosy Tanikely for world-class snorkeling and Nosy Komba to visit the local handicraft markets.

How do I get to the guesthouse? Most guests arrive via a flight into Nosy Be Fascene Airport. We arrange a private transfer that takes approximately 30–40 minutes, bringing you through the lush ylang-ylang plantations and local villages before arriving at the coastal sanctuary of Ambatoloaka.
